package core

import "testing"

const (
	ownerID = 1
	otherID = 2
)

func repoWith(v Visibility) *Repo {
	return &Repo{ID: 10, Name: "db", OwnerID: ownerID, OwnerName: "owner", Path: "/x", Visibility: v}
}

func ptr(m AccessMode) *AccessMode { return &m }

// grant bundles the four operation outcomes for one matrix cell.
type grant struct{ browse, clone, push, admin bool }

func (g grant) want(op Op) bool {
	switch op {
	case OpBrowse:
		return g.browse
	case OpCloneRead:
		return g.clone
	case OpPush:
		return g.push
	case OpAdmin:
		return g.admin
	}
	return false
}

func TestAllowedMatrix(t *testing.T) {
	anon := (*Caller)(nil)
	user := &Caller{UserID: otherID, Username: "user", UserType: UserTypeUser}
	owner := &Caller{UserID: ownerID, Username: "owner", UserType: UserTypeUser}
	suspendedOwner := &Caller{UserID: ownerID, Username: "owner", UserType: UserTypeSuspended, Suspended: true}
	suspendedUser := &Caller{UserID: otherID, Username: "user", UserType: UserTypeSuspended, Suspended: true}

	readOnly := grant{browse: true, clone: true}
	readWrite := grant{browse: true, clone: true, push: true}
	all := grant{browse: true, clone: true, push: true, admin: true}
	none := grant{}

	tests := []struct {
		name   string
		caller *Caller
		repo   *Repo
		acl    *AccessMode
		want   grant
	}{
		// anonymous, no ACL
		{"anon/public", anon, repoWith(VisibilityPublic), nil, readOnly},
		{"anon/unlisted", anon, repoWith(VisibilityUnlisted), nil, readOnly},
		{"anon/private", anon, repoWith(VisibilityPrivate), nil, none},

		// authenticated non-owner, no ACL (same as anonymous)
		{"user/public", user, repoWith(VisibilityPublic), nil, readOnly},
		{"user/unlisted", user, repoWith(VisibilityUnlisted), nil, readOnly},
		{"user/private", user, repoWith(VisibilityPrivate), nil, none},

		// ACL RO grant: browse+clone on every visibility, incl. PRIVATE
		{"acl-ro/public", user, repoWith(VisibilityPublic), ptr(AccessRO), readOnly},
		{"acl-ro/unlisted", user, repoWith(VisibilityUnlisted), ptr(AccessRO), readOnly},
		{"acl-ro/private", user, repoWith(VisibilityPrivate), ptr(AccessRO), readOnly},

		// ACL RW grant: + push, never admin, on every visibility
		{"acl-rw/public", user, repoWith(VisibilityPublic), ptr(AccessRW), readWrite},
		{"acl-rw/unlisted", user, repoWith(VisibilityUnlisted), ptr(AccessRW), readWrite},
		{"acl-rw/private", user, repoWith(VisibilityPrivate), ptr(AccessRW), readWrite},

		// owner: everything on every visibility
		{"owner/public", owner, repoWith(VisibilityPublic), nil, all},
		{"owner/unlisted", owner, repoWith(VisibilityUnlisted), nil, all},
		{"owner/private", owner, repoWith(VisibilityPrivate), nil, all},

		// suspended: reads only, never push/admin
		{"suspended-owner/private", suspendedOwner, repoWith(VisibilityPrivate), nil, readOnly},
		{"suspended-owner/public", suspendedOwner, repoWith(VisibilityPublic), nil, readOnly},
		{"suspended-user-rw/private", suspendedUser, repoWith(VisibilityPrivate), ptr(AccessRW), readOnly},
		{"suspended-user-rw/public", suspendedUser, repoWith(VisibilityPublic), ptr(AccessRW), readOnly},
		{"suspended-user-ro/private", suspendedUser, repoWith(VisibilityPrivate), ptr(AccessRO), readOnly},
	}

	ops := []Op{OpBrowse, OpCloneRead, OpPush, OpAdmin}
	for _, tt := range tests {
		t.Run(tt.name, func(t *testing.T) {
			for _, op := range ops {
				got := Allowed(tt.caller, tt.repo, tt.acl, op)
				want := tt.want.want(op)
				if got != want {
					t.Errorf("Allowed(%s, %s) = %v, want %v", tt.name, op, got, want)
				}
			}
		})
	}
}

func TestAllowedUnknownOpDenied(t *testing.T) {
	owner := &Caller{UserID: ownerID}
	if Allowed(owner, repoWith(VisibilityPublic), nil, Op(99)) {
		t.Fatal("unknown op must be denied even for the owner")
	}
}

func TestAllowedNilRepoDenied(t *testing.T) {
	owner := &Caller{UserID: ownerID}
	for _, op := range []Op{OpBrowse, OpCloneRead, OpPush, OpAdmin} {
		if Allowed(owner, nil, nil, op) {
			t.Fatalf("nil repo must deny %s", op)
		}
	}
}

func TestNotFoundForPrivate(t *testing.T) {
	anon := (*Caller)(nil)
	user := &Caller{UserID: otherID}
	owner := &Caller{UserID: ownerID}

	tests := []struct {
		name   string
		caller *Caller
		repo   *Repo
		acl    *AccessMode
		want   bool
	}{
		{"nil-repo", anon, nil, nil, true},
		{"public-anon", anon, repoWith(VisibilityPublic), nil, false},
		{"unlisted-anon", anon, repoWith(VisibilityUnlisted), nil, false},
		{"private-anon-hidden", anon, repoWith(VisibilityPrivate), nil, true},
		{"private-unauthorized-user-hidden", user, repoWith(VisibilityPrivate), nil, true},
		{"private-owner-visible", owner, repoWith(VisibilityPrivate), nil, false},
		{"private-acl-ro-visible", user, repoWith(VisibilityPrivate), ptr(AccessRO), false},
	}
	for _, tt := range tests {
		t.Run(tt.name, func(t *testing.T) {
			if got := NotFoundForPrivate(tt.caller, tt.repo, tt.acl); got != tt.want {
				t.Fatalf("NotFoundForPrivate(%s) = %v, want %v", tt.name, got, tt.want)
			}
		})
	}
}
